Assessment of costs of sidewalk or curb construction and other improvements.
Notwithstanding any provision to
the contrary in ORS 371.605 to 371.660, the cost of construction of sidewalks
under those sections shall be assessed in proportion to the front footage of
the land or otherwise, as provided in those sections, to the owners of land
abutting on the side of the street or road on which the sidewalks are
constructed and fronting on such sidewalks. The cost of construction of all
other improvements under those sections shall be assessed, in the manner
provided in those sections, to the owners of land benefited by the improvement.
[1955 c.773 §12; 1971 c.327 §6]
